Welcome to the 20th Annual “Best of the Breeds” Bull Sale on Sunday, March 24, 2024, at Heartland Livestock, Yorkton, Saskatchewan. It has taken twenty years...but well worth the “weight!”
2024 is the largest and strongest lineup ever presented by the Best of the Breed consignors. In the past twenty years this sale has been a “onestop” shopping center in supplying value added sires for both commercial and purebred sectors alike. These breeds, the Whites, the Sims, the Gups and the Red and Black Angus compliment themselves in producing the ideal feeder calf and replacement heifers.
The Charolais offering is exciting...the Harcourts offer sons of Summit, Badge, and Patriot...homo polled, full of muscle and capacity. Dog Patch introduces a new outcross in Ruger, and the big weaning sire Highlight as well as a large lineup of sons by the predictable Houston. A great set of bulls with breeder potential. The folks at Fairview bring the strongest set of bulls since inception. What a Fleck/Fullblood offering they present. Mainly polled, and homo polled, this is one of the largest offerings of Fullbloods in the country. The Purebreds are hairy, rugged, and will work with all types of programs...reds, blacks, and blazes. Fairview can fill your Simmental needs.
Blair and family bring you a top set of Gelbvieh prospects sired by Hitch and Element. All homo polled...red in colour with one black heifer bull. These bulls are optimum in calving ease and will add pounds at weaning...you’ll want to keep their daughters for replacement pastures.
Black Ridge Angus offer sons of Homegrown, a new sire in their program...you will like their style, shape and hair with optimal birth weight. Sons of Bravo will add power, while Bankroll will add length and the DeWalt’s will add maternal replacement strength into his female progeny.
The boys at Twin Heritage offer an exciting presentation sired by Helix...bulls with calving ease and maternal strength where you will want to keep all the daughters. Consistent in type and kind the Helix sons will add style and eye appeal.

Welcome to another bull sale season and thank you for your interest and support of our program throughout the years. The bulls that we have this year are backed by proven genetics and a cow herd built with an emphasis on fertility, sound udder structure, and good feet. We welcome you to check out the herd and mothers of these bulls in person as we are confident that you will be hard pressed to find a bad foot or udder. We take great pride in having developed a herd focussed on these important attributes that are all too often overlooked.
We started the bulls a little later with feed this year but you can be assured, they will be ready to breed when you need them. We continue to pail feed a balanced bull developer ration to ensure responsible development and longevity with access to free choice hay, mineral, and water. The weights provided are actuals with WW taken early in the fall on August 28 and YW taken on February 11.

This is the second set of sons to be sold out of our Helix 635H bull. We are extremely impressed with how easy the Helix calves were born and how the bulls have developed. The sons have calving ease appeal with moderate BW, length, and style. Helix’s exceptional dam has been a long-time herd matron and donor cow at Wilbar. It is evident from the first calf heifers, that the Helix 635H daughters will impress with strong maternal traits and tidy even udders. These sons are noted for their balance, length of body, testicle development, and calving ease appeal.

Terms:
The terms of the sale are cash or cheque, payable at par at the sale location. The right of property shall not pass until after settlement has been made; no invoicing on buyers in attendance, unless previous arrangements have been made. Every animal sells to the highest bidder and in cases of disputes, the auctioneer’s decision will be final. Current exchange rates will be announced sale day. All monies are in Canadian funds.
Bidding:
Each animal will sell to the highest bidder. In the case of a dispute, bidding will be reopened between the parties involved in the dispute. If no further bidding is made, the buyer will be the person from whom the auctioneer accepted the last bid. The auctioneer’s decision on all disputes will be final.
Announcements:
All announcements made from the auction block will take precedence over the printed matter in the catalogue. Buyers are therefore cautioned to pay close attention to such disclosures.
Breeder’s Guarantee:
Should any bull fourteen (14) months of age or over fail to prove a breeder after being used on females known to be breeders, the matter shall be reported in writing to the seller within six (6) months following the date of purchase or six (6) months after the bull has reached fourteen (14) months of age. The seller will have the right and privilege of six (6) months to prove the bull a breeder. No guarantee is given that semen collected from the bull will freeze.
Exception Guarantee:
In cases where the animal is subjected to any hormonal or surgical reproduction techniques after the sale, this guarantee shall be null and void.
Certificate of Registration:
Each animal will carry papers issued by the Canadian Charolais, Angus, Simmental, and Gelbvieh Associations.
A certificate of registry duly transferred will be furnished to the buyer for each animal after payment has been made.
Pedigree Estimates
Pedigree Estimates (PE) are created on the projected mating of the animal’s sire and dam based on averages of the two, creating estimated values that do not hold the same accuracy of actual EPDs issued from the association and should be used as such.
